通用树脂有苯乙烯挥发性,耐腐蚀性能差、气干性不良、易形成裂纹等缺陷,加入双环戊二烯进行改性,树脂的固化速度差异不大,同时树脂具有很好的韧性,由于DCPD树脂与苯乙烯有较好的相容性,可以降低苯乙烯含量,树脂黏度没有较大的变化.本研究采用催化水解加成法研究了"工业级"双环戊二烯为主要原料合成不饱和聚酯树脂的新工艺及性能.双环戊二烯的含量低于80%,研究了各种影响因素,得出最佳的主要工艺条件,对促进新工艺的研究和生产具有重要的意义.

Based on general resins,a new modified unsaturated polyester resin with good air drying property,good corrosion resistance and low styrene volatilization was developed in this paper.General purpose resin has defects such as styrene volatility,poor corrosion resistance,poor air drying,easy to form cracks,etc.Adding bicyclopentadiene(DCPD)to modify the resin,the curing speed of the resin is not different,and the resin has good toughness.Because DCPD resin has good compatibility with styrene,the content of styrene can be reduced,and the viscosity of the resin does not change greatly.The new process and properties of industrial bicyclopentadiene(dicyclopentadiene)synthesized unsaturated polyester resin were studied by catalytic hydrolysis addition method.The content of dicyclopentadiene is less than 80%,and various influencing factors are studied to obtain the best main process conditions,which is of great significance to promote the research and production of the new process.
